Summary of position
We are looking for several motivated Summer Students, with full-time availability, to support production activities at our manufacturing facility in London, Ontario. Positions range in duties but you may be responsible for assisting in the completion of production orders, quality inspections, and inventory management. You may also be assisting Operators in standard preventative maintenance of machinery and with purging and organizing workstations.

Here are some of the different activities you’ll be asked to do:

  • Packing and feeding the product on the machines.
  • Perform routine quality checks.
  • Assist Operators when necessary.
  • Ensure proper skids are available as per specs.
  • Seal and label corrugate, pile on skids and move to inspection areas.
  • Fill out the necessary paperwork and required data entry within SAP.
  • Ensure that all requirements of the JHG Quality Management System are followed.
  • Ensure all applicable Health & Safety Management system policies & procedures and Environmental (ISO 14001) Management System policies & procedures are followed.
